  3. 2 choices, with windows, you can change the basic disk you have into a dynamic disk. then you can extend the volume to use the rest of the space available. you can use a partition program like partition magic to extend the basic partition

  10. you need to run the backup using shadow copy, during the backup the mailbox DB is unavailable if shadow copy is not used, and if you are doing a full backup nightly (which you should be if the DB allows for it) then people will not be able to use mail until the DB is finish being backed up, check your backup and make sure it is using VSS,

  14. ok same rules apply, go into IIS, go to the Virtual SMTP connector, got to properties, go into the access tab, here under relays it should be set to allow only the list below and the check box below should be checked click on the authentication button and uncheck basic and intergrated authentication if they are selected. this should take care of the issue, if you are still getting spam routed through it, under connections on the access tab you can deny access to it to the IP{ of the spam server they are sending from, or the domain it is coming from
  15. sam, how is your email system setup? is it exchange? what version? is it a front end - backend solution? we w ould need to know some of these thigns to help more to take of your initial issue of, you need to turn off the authentication, set the smtp server to authenticate anonymous. to send and receive email from the internet, you need to have the smtp server that connects to the internet set with anonymous access By default, SMTP virtual servers are configured to relay outbound messages sent from authenticated users and to relay incoming messages sent to the private domain. If you allow more open relaying, your server might be used as a spam relay where messages sent from the Internet are relayed through your server to other Internet hosts. check your Virtual SMTP server for settings about open relay (sorry can't think of exactly where it is atm) but open relay should be off (this allows spammers to use your mail server to router though)

  21. i would inject all your drivers that are common for your computers in offline mode, if the only reason to go into audit mode (ie apps and such you want installed before booting for the first time, from the CHM Unattend Windows Setup Reference Build a Reference Image Scenario In this scenario, you create a single Windows reference image that you can reuse throughout your environment. This scenario involves the following steps: 1. You start with a Windows product DVD and an answer file. 2. You boot the Windows product DVD. 3. Windows Setup starts and the windowsPE and offlineServicing passes run. 4. After the Windows image is copied to the hard disk, the system reboots and Windows Setup runs the specialize pass. 5. After Windows Setup completes, the oobeSystem configuration pass runs and Windows Welcome starts. 6. You can make additional modifications to the system. Install applications, device drivers, or other configurations. this is a good time to install a common apps and drivers for your machines (ie office, adobe reader etc,) 7. When you complete your modifications, you run sysprep /generalize /audit /reboot. This command runs the generalize pass and then removes any system-specific data. Also, this configures Windows to run audit mode on the next boot (running the auditSystem and auditUser configuration passes). the Audit pass is a time where you would launch scripts and files for specific computers or roles for computers. Say you launch a script to check if a computer has a CD-burner and enable windows cd-burning, of check to see if a computer is a laptop and then install or configure VPN software for it. if you are doing other steps here it would also be a good time for drivers if you have alot of different makes and models. This image then becomes your reference image that you can save to install on computers of the same configuration.
